#4975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4975ec is composed of 28.6% red, 45.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#4975ec color hex could be obtained by blending #92eaff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4975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4975ec has RGB values of R:73, G:117,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4814316.

Shades and Tints of #4975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050d is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4975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96999f is the less saturated color, while #3a6efb is the most saturated one.
